Hi Gideon,
I've been on Goodreads since the beginning of the year. I really enjoy the site. Of course, as an author, it supplies some promotional visibility for me because people at least see me, but I mostly use the site as a reader. I like the "to-read" list because I can stick titles here that I am interested in. Because so many books catch my eye, it's a nice list. This way instead of forgetting what I think is interesting, I actually have a place to refer to when I am looking for something to read. I also peruse the ratings and reviews of the other readers that are my friends. I usually form a reading friendship if I see a review that interests me or someone tends to read the type of books I like. This way I get exposed to new titles on a regular basis and can use a friend's rating to gauge potential quality. This is my goodreads URL: http://www.goodreads.com/profile/Tracy_Falbe |
